Transaction 7b44509d066f66478760b7a2825318762a02ead83a50713afb17038151b65fca
3 Input
1 Outputs
- 7b44509d066f66478760b7a2825318762a02ead83a50713afb17038151b65fca:0
value 15270000
address 2MyWNe1gJuexZdNpucaoCvUCNmYgh4HVqZy